SpaceX has successfully launched the Falcon 9 missile carrying the Spanish satellite PAZ and the two Microsat-2a and Microsat-2b satellites, which will test the technology for creating a large satellite network for the satellite Internet, N + 1 reports..

The system will consist of almost 12,000 satellites weighing several hundred kilograms, divided into two groups. One of them will be located at an altitude of 1110 to 1325 kilometers, and the second is much lower, at an altitude of 335 to 346 kilometers. Satellites will be able to exchange information with both terminals on the Earth, and with each other.

February 22 at about 16:17 in Kyiv SpaceX launched the first two satellites of the system. The first stage of the missile was already used during another launch in August 2017, but this time the company decided not to plant it after launch. 11 minutes after launch from the second stage the Spanish satellite of remote sensing of the Earth PAZ. He will be able to take pictures of the Earth's surface with a resolution of up to 25 centimeters.



This launch is also notable for the fact that this time the company used a new version of the head fairing, half of which it will try to land on. Previously, the media reported that the Falcon 9 booster failed to deliver the secret government satellite Zuma into orbit.

According to preliminary information from the interlocutors of journalists, due to a malfunction, the satellite could not separate from the second stage of the launch vehicle and fell with it into the ocean. This is reported by "The Mirror of the Week. Ukraine".
